I mentioned here that I attended an estate sale 3-4 weeks ago and bought 4 rusty old axes for $3 apiece. Once I cleaned them up, only two of them had any markings (a Craftsman and a Sager), but the other two were unmarked, although I knew by style, etc, who the manufacturer was. Still, unmarked axes don't bring a premium. I'd list one, once it sold, I'd drag out another one, clean it up and list it. No rush, I just took my time. Well heck, it's been less than a month and all four of them have sold as of today. I just turned $12 worth of rusty old axes into $337.45 in the blink of an eye! Ha ha ha! Yeah, it's startin' to look like that. Of course I have a ton of misc. stuff listed, but I have a habit of categorizing some stuff and group things together by category. Then I let the supply build up until the urge hits me to start listing a particular type of item, then I go through the pile. The last couple months of the year, I got the urge to start selling off a pile of old Pyrex mixing bowls I'd let accumulate. Bottom line on old Pyrex bowls for the month of December? $1044.22! I'd acquired a pile of axes and didn't start fooling with them until sometime last month, so I sold a couple in January. For some odd reason (no rhyme or reason really), I only list one at a time. I'll clean one up (minor cleaning, maybe 15-mins. per axe) and list it. When it sells, I'll list another one and so forth. This is what has sold so far just in February, so I'm averaging 1/week. (I guess it's time to clean up another one) ;)

Bottom line paid by buyers, Total: $413.32 Nice return considering I refuse to pay more than $5/axe. (the small, boy's axe (#3) was badly rusted and extremely pitted)

Been running some elderly (mid-80’s) friends around and now waiting for their 1st Covid shot appts. (4:00 & 4:15), so I figured I’d check in. I haven’t run across any hammered iron in quite a while. That stuff is like gold with the CI collectors. I have that pile pictured above, as well as a smaller pile I’ve started. I don’t even have a clue what all is in there. I pick ‘em up, bring ‘em home, add ‘em to the pile and forget about ‘em for a while. Every once in a while, I’ll get the bug and start digging a few things out to list. Like the Pyrex in Nov -Dec, axes Jan -Feb, etc. No clue why I do that, just one of my idiosyncrasies I guess. I think before the Pyrex, I went through a stage of listing old wood working tools and before that, hand tools (wrenches, etc). In between, I list misc. singular stuff. I guess it keeps me from getting bored when I change things up. I’ve tapped into a HUGE market for vintage (citrus) juicers and sell them year round. I probably have 40-50 of them in inventory at any given time. Oddly, 90% of those sales go to California.
